General Joseph P. FranklinGeneral Joseph P. Franklin graduated from West Point in 1955 with a commission in the U.S. Army Corps of Engineers. He was assigned to Karlsruhe, Germany, and served with Combat Engineer units until 1959. He earned his Masters degrees in Civil Engineering and Nuclear Engineering at MIT. Franklin was selected to be Commandant of Cadets at West Point, where he served until 1982. From there, he was promoted to Major General and assigned in 1983 as Chief of the Joint U.S. Military Group and Senior U.S. Defense Representative in Spain.
